The admission to the LL.M. programme at National Law Universities (NLUs) is typically based on the Common Law Admission Test (CLAT) and the fulfillment of the minimum eligibility criteria. The minimum cutoff for the LL.M. programme may vary between NLUs. For example, the National Law School of India University (NLSIU) requires candidates to have at least 55% marks in LL.B from a recognised university for the LL.M. program. Additionally, reservations are provided to different categories, including Specially Abled Persons (SAP) and foreign nationals, for the LL.M. programme at various NLUs.

For studying LLM at the University of Nottingham, international students are required to have £22,600 (Around INR 24 lakh). Apart from the tuition fees, students have to pay the amount for living expenses. The University of Nottingham offers a range of international merit scholarships for high-achieving international scholars who can put their Nottingham degrees to great use in their careers. One of these scholarships is South Asia Postgraduate Excellence Award which has a value of £4,000 – £8,000 towards the tuition fees.

To study at UON UK for the LLM course, the entry requirements for international students are given below:

  • An undergraduate degree of 2:1 or international equivalent in Law, Humanities or Social Science
  • IELTS with a score of 6.5 with no less than 6.5 in Reading and Writing, and 6.0 in Speaking and Listening / any other equivalent ELP test scores

The Bar Council of India and UGC have not approved the distance learning mode for education in PG LLM program. So no University in India is permitted to offer LLM through distance education mode.
